How old do you have to be to get your GED in Michigan?
1. Title of State Credential: High School Equivalency Certificate 2. Requirements for Issuance of Certificate: A. Minimum Test Scores: For ALL LANGUAGE editions (i.e., English, Spanish and French) of the GED test, a standard score of 410 on each of the five tests and an average standard score of 450 for all five tests is required. B. Minimum Age: 18 years of age and class of which applicant would have been a member must have graduated. Individuals who are graduates of the Michigan Department of Military and Veterans Affairs, National Guard Michigan Youth Challenge Program qualify for a Michigan GED certificate if they are at least 16 years of age, and successfully complete all GED tests in accordance with Michigan jurisdictional score requirements. C. High Schools are authorized to issue high school diplomas or certificates on the basis of the GED test to adult residents provided applicants meet the following requirements: I. Minimum Test Scores: A standard score of 410 on each of the five tests and an average standard score of 450 on all five tests. II. Minimum Age: None, but diplomas or certificates will not be granted ahead of the time applicants would have received the credentials had they remained in school, except for Michigan Youth Challenge Program graduates. III. Residence: Must be a former student or present resident of the school district from which the diploma or certificate of equivalency is sought; residents in a non-high school district may apply to the high school serving the particular district. IV. Previous High School Enrollment: The local high school may require a year or more of previous high school enrollment in addition to attaining the minimum test scores on the GED test. 3. Minimum Age for Testing: A. Individuals who are at least 16 years of age and have been out of a regular school program for one calendar year may be tested. The calendar year waiting requirement may be waived if it is in the best interest of the individual as determined by a school district's superintendent or designee and parent/guardian and is in accordance with State approved GED testing center guidelines. A GED testing center must retain documentation of this waiver requirement signed by the student, parent/guardian and school district's superintendent or designee. This documentation shall include language that GED testing is in the best interest of the examinee and has been approved by the above-mentioned signatories. B. Michigan National Guard Youth Challenge Program graduates who are at least 16 years of age and no longer enrolled in high school are eligible for testing upon completion of the program. C. Applicants for induction into the U.S. Armed Forces who are age 17 may be admitted to testing, provided a written request is made by the recruiting office of any branch of the Armed Forces stating that the applicant has met all military requirements for induction except for GED test scores, and provided request is accompanied by letter or written statement signed by the local school official stating that the individual has left school and that it would probably be in the best interest of the person to be admitted to testing and, also, a letter of permission for induction from the applicant's parent or guardian is furnished. 4. Requirements for Retesting: Retesting is at discretion of the chief examiner, however, applicants are counseled to enroll in preparatory programs and it is recommended that six months should have elapsed before retesting. 5. Method of Applying: No State application is required. Testing scores and applicant information is obtained directly from GED Testing Centers and GED High School Equivalency certificates are mailed when applicants meet all requirements. 6. Official Transcripts: Test scores are accepted as official only when reported directly by: A. Official GED Testing Centers B. Transcript Service of the Defense Activity for Non-Traditional Education Support (DANTES C. GED Testing Service. 7. Fees: A. Testing fees at Official GED Testing centers varies and there is no fee for a certificate. B. An official report of GED test scores may be obtained from the GED testing centers. Transcript cost information is available from each test center C. Duplicate certificates are not issued 8. Testing Center Locations: Information on the location of Michigan GED testing centers is available on the internet at: http://www.michigan.gov/adulteducation by following the links to GED. It depends on the university, obviously, but if the university doesn't have strict SAT requirements, etc, then most will. Note that colleges and universities have limited spots to fill during admissions, and are looking for a variety of people, so not everyone who applies (qualified or not) gets in. Talk to an admissions counselor at the university you are interested in, and explain the situation. They can advise you on what you need to do, and on things you can do to improve your chances if that is needed.
Your chances are pretty terrible of being accepted if you have a GED and (from what I gathered?) juvenile record. Even without the record, things are still not very shiny. However, if you go to a local 2-year school for a year, you do have quite a good shot at transferring into a reputable 4-year school (assuming you can get some good SAT scores and a strong GPA at the community college). It's been done many times. I would call your local community college about starting classes as soon as possible (you usually need at least 30 credits to qualify as a sophomore transfer). So long as you're a sophomore transfer student, they usually won't inquire about your high school record at all.

Can you stay on campus with a GED?
Yes. Virtually no College or University requires a High School Diploma or GED to be accepted for study. Most applicants that are accepted to Colleges or Universities are accepted during their Senior year before they graduate. Some College or University students begin as 'early entrants', meaning they begin their studies after 1, 2, or 3 years of High School without ever earning a High School diploma or GED.

How old do you have to be to take a GED test in Ohio?
GED Age Requirements To take the Ohio GED test, you must be officially withdrawn from school and be 19 years of age or older. Exceptions to the age requirement may be granted if:
You are 18 years of age -
Have the Superintendent (or designee) of the school district where you last attended (or the district where you live) complete and sign the GED Age Waiver Form. Attach it to your paper application or to the confirmation page from your online application.
You are 18 years of age AND your class has graduated -
Attach an Official School Transcript to your application to show that your class has graduated. If you have been sworn into active military service in one of the armed forces, attach a sworn statement to your application giving the date of the swearing-in ceremony. (Delayed entry candidates do not qualify.)
You are at least 16 years of age, but less than 18 years of age -
The Superintendent (or designee) of the school district where you last attended (or the district where you live) must complete and sign the GED Age Waiver Form. A parent, guardian or court official must sign the GED Parental Consent Form. Attach both forms to your paper application or to the confirmation page from your online application.
For more information, see the Ohio Administrative Code (OAC), section 3301-41-01, Standard for issuing an "Ohio High School Equivalence Diploma" located at http://codes.ohio.gov/.
